Output 58530240d34f927f1ec9bb9e2e6a22edc50834c280eb998cb5d82e26dfd05726:7

value
4255208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80bbbe8025df2fd82ec76dba5d1b9ae097daf387 OP_EQUAL
address
3DRhKnm5xFsE5Md4n8u82dLebHJTNGpwXk
transaction
58530240d34f927f1ec9bb9e2e6a22edc50834c280eb998cb5d82e26dfd05726
spent
true